HUNTINGDON, Pa. – The Juniata men's basketball team fell to Immaculata University, 67-58, in a non-conference matchup Saturday afternoon. Despite a strong rebounding effort (40-26), the Eagles struggled with turnovers (24) and poor three-point shooting, making just 2 of 11 attempts (18.2%).
Tyler Lapetina led Juniata with 13 points, five rebounds, and five assists, while Mason Hardy added 10 points. Malcolm Griffith came off the bench to score 12 points and grab six rebounds. Immaculata shot 43.4% from the field, including 38.9% from three-point range, and made 70.0% of their free throws.
Immaculata led by nine at halftime, 36-27, and although Juniata made a push in the second half to cut the deficit to six points, they couldn't get any closer. Dylan Crews led Immaculata with 14 points, going a perfect 6-6 from the field.
Juniata will take on Hood College in the consolation game tomorrow at 2:00 PM in Memorial Gymnasium.
